Как указать необходимость наличия определенной зависимости в проекте при установке собственного пакета из npm?

Как определить зависимость от библиотеки компонентов, на которой основан ваш кастомный компонент уведомлений и обеспечить автоматическую установку необходимой версии этой библиотеки при установке вашего пакета из npm?
  • 15 июля 2024 г. 7:42
Ответы на вопрос 2
Для указания необходимости наличия определенной зависимости в проекте при установке вашего собственного пакета, вы можете внести эту зависимость в секцию "dependencies" вашего файла package.json. 

Например, если ваш кастомный компонент уведомлений зависит от библиотеки компонентов "react", вы можете добавить в раздел "dependencies" следующую строку: 

```json
"dependencies": {
   "react": "^17.0.2"
}
```

Таким образом, при установке вашего пакета из npm, будет автоматически установлена необходимая версия библиотеки "react".

Если ваш пакет зависит от других пакетов, вы также можете добавить их в раздел "dependencies" вашего package.json файла соответствующим образом.
Похожие вопросы